While donations are down for the Salvation Army’s Red Kettle Program; somebody dropped a $50 Gold Coin in the Red Kettle in Montgomery County.

The coin has a face value of $50, but the Salvation Army says it may be worth as much as $1,200.

Whoever dropped the coin did it in front of the Giant in Cabin John, Maryland, on Saturday.

Money raised through the annual drive helps families and individuals through a variety of services and programs.
